Variables cleanup: PathVariable
Part 4 of a series, updating the PathVariable implementation, tests and docstrings. Signed-off-by: Mats Wichmann <mats@linux.com>

class _PathVariableClass:
+ """Class implementing path variables.
+
+ This class exists mainly to expose the validators without code having
+ to import the names: they will appear as methods of ``PathVariable``,
+ a statically created instance of this class, which is placed in
+ the SConscript namespace.
+
+ Instances are callable to produce a suitable variable tuple.
+ """
